    This report is the first publication of a study of the market for 3D printing with biomaterials in Russia and the world.

    The purpose of the study is to analyze the Russian market of biological 3D printers.

    The object of the study are only 3D bioprinters that print components of living cells (similar devices for metals, polymers, ceramics and composite materials for medical purposes are left outside of this report).

    This work is a desk study. As sources of information, data from scientific, industry and regional press, annual and quarterly reports of issuers of securities, websites of equipment manufacturers, the state R&D database and the FIPS patent database were used.

    Timeline of the study: 2017-2022

    Research geography: Russian Federation in detail, world overview.

     

    The report consists of 5 chapters, contains 85 pages, including 21 tables, 17 figures, and 2 appendices.

    The first chapter of the report provides information about the global market for biological 3D printing.

    The second chapter of the report provides data on the world's main manufacturers of printers and materials for biological 3D printing.

    The third chapter of the report discusses the legal problems of using biological 3D printers in world medicine using living cells from animals and humans.

    In the fourth chapter of the report, the Russian market for biological 3D printing is outlined, the main developers of domestic bioprinters and materials for them are considered, export-import operations are analyzed, a patent analysis of inventions in the field of bioprinting is performed, registers of open purchases and grants for R&D in the field of bioprinting are compiled, prices are summarized on bioprinters in the Russian Federation, summarized data on the consumption of bioprinters are given.

    The fifth chapter of the report presents a forecast for the development of Russian biological 3D printing for humans in 2023-2025.

     

    The highlight of the report is a detailed review of the profile of all well-known manufacturers of biological 3D printers for humans in Russia, an overview of R&D topics and their financing, as well as information on Russian patents for inventions and utility models, certificates for computer programs, databases in the field of bioprinting.
